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
0863689926 0968 129274 6469 22710452888
68128 72 7781
68128 72 7781
588562909 211758387 90839486114
All about undefined
Interested in learning more?
68128 72 7781
588562909 211758387 90839486114
See more
456161988 58790220
469381304 65 292417
See more
01029150 19
616 543 609034 087320
See more